What Is a Bottle?

A narrow-necked, rigid or semirigid container primarily used for holding liquids. Bottles may be made of glass or plastic. The name derives from the part of a bottle with a neck smaller than its body, which provides a mouth for pouring or sucking. Bottles are widely used for drinking water and other beverages, but also serve in medical applications such as enema and feeding tubes. They are also a common item found on the shelves of stores and pharmacies.

A common type of bottle is a glass one, a material that has been used for both practical and decorative purposes since ancient times. Glass is relatively hard, brittle and impervious to the elements, which makes it useful for containers such as jugs and bowls. The chemical composition of glass is essentially silica sand mixed with sodium oxide and calcium carbonate. Iron impurities give a greenish color, which can be corrected by adding selenium and cobalt oxide to the melting mix.

In the past, bottles were often hand-blown or pressed to form their shape. Today, bottles are usually formed by blow molding or other forms of plastic extrusion. The plastics used to make bottles are often derived from petroleum, with polyethylene terephthalate (PET) being the most common. The production process for PET releases pollutants such as nickel, ethylene oxide and benzene into the wastewater, which can then leak back into soil or waterways.

Plastics have provided numerous benefits in the modern world, but they can also be a significant source of pollution. For example, single-use plastic water bottles are a major component of ocean debris. When these bottles reach the end of their life, they can be carried by wind or storms to sewers, rivers and other waterways that ultimately deposit them in the ocean. Plastic bottles, along with other plastic waste, take a long time to break down in the environment, and can leach chemicals and toxins into surrounding soils or water bodies.

How to Position a Baby Bottle

A bottle is a narrow-necked, rigid or semirigid container that is primarily used to hold liquids and semiliquids. It usually has a close-fitting stopper or cap to protect the contents from spills, evaporation or contact with foreign substances. Bottles are commonly made of glass, but plastic and other materials are also used. Bottles are typically used to transport and store foods, beverages, chemicals, and other substances, but they can also be used as containers for medical purposes and pharmaceuticals. A bottle may have an embossed label that contains information about the contents of the bottle, its manufacturer and other relevant details. A bottle may also have a handle, which makes it easier to grasp.

During a bottle feed, infants require the assistance of their parent or caregiver to control the flow of milk into their mouths (Kassing, 2002). The positioning of the bottle and the infant during a bottle feed affects the infant’s oral feeding skills and ultimately the feeding outcome. The positioning of the bottle is particularly important for infants who rely on their bottle to obtain breastmilk or formula from an artificial source (AAP, 2006).
